Figured I'd post up a quick makeshift video of the car to show everybody that it actually does run and drive lol. The first part of the vid is kinda corny, I was going to edit some music in there but I got lazy so if you don't want to watch the corny part skip to about 2:10 into the vid. The car is on a laggy ass 57 trim + supporting mods at 23psi 91 octane and afrs from 10.8-11.6 which I need to work on. To show how laggy the turbo feels in 1st gear, the first run is WOT right off the line, the 2nd run on the turnaround is a 2nd to 1st downshift and the turbo spools quickly. The vid from outside the car is also a WOT run too. Once the car gets moving it's a beast, it just can't get out of it's own way in first. Hopefully a better tune will help out, but we'll see. ^^^^ what he said. I had an exhaust manifold gasket completely blowout on me at the track and I was still trapping 104mph on slicks. On stock turbo with slicks I trapped 92mph so I picked up 12mph but could only manage a 14.0 because I couldn't spool up off the line with a blown exhaust gasket. Replaced the gasket the other day and fired it up to make sure there were no leaks then shut the car off and grabbed my stuff for school, headed back out to the car and now it won't start. I've replaced the starter, it's got a brand new battery, I pulled the shield off the tranny and spun the flexplate so the motor's not froze...the fucker just doesn't want to run anymore. With a blown gasket on 17psi I dynoed 300/310 though on 91 octane. I was going for broke at the track with 110 octane plus 100% meth injection but the more I turned the boost up the worse it got because of that leak. Quote: Originally Posted by mk3tunershop View Post
automatic? i have a mexican stratus rt 2.4 dohc turbo with the a604 automatic trans and itss sooooo weakkk!! any ideas?

I blew my first trans up at 22k miles on stock turbo + a few mods. As long as you don't boost in OD you'll be alright for awhile but yeah they are peices of shit that's for sure. I had mine built for me and I've beat the dog crap out of it for the last thousand miles, the only thing I could get it to do was break flexplates and destroy torque converter bolts (3 sets) but the trans seemed to hold up ok lol
